Wood doors have long be...Sand the Surface. Put on the safety goggles and dust mask. Scrape any peeling areas with the paint scraper. Sand the existing paint by hand until the door feels even all over, starting with medium 120-grit sandpaper and working your way up to fine 220-grit sandpaper; if the door still feels rough, finish with 320-grit sandpaper. Here ...For panel doors: Start by applying paint to the inner panels and the surrounding mouldings. Next, tackle the central areas working your way from top to bottom. Finish with the outer edges, including the exposed door edges right at the end. For glazed doors: Affix masking tape around the edges of the glass panels to protect it from drips of paint.Feb 20, 2024 · Remove Door. Tap out the pins in the door hinges. Place the sharp end of the nail at the bottom of the pin. Tap until enough of the pin protrudes for you to pull it out by hand. With the pins out, slide the door off. Leave the other half of the hinges on the door casing. Nov 9, 2022 · Step 2: Sand the Door. Next sand the door using a sanding block. I used a sanding block that was about 100 grit. The purpose of sanding the door isn’t to remove all the existing paint, but to rough up the top shiny layer so that the new paint can adhere better. Try to sand in all of the grooves and detailed spaces. Step 6: Sand and Wipe Down the Door. Once the primer completely dries, use the sandpaper to lightly scuff the primer, carefully clearing the surface of any uneven spots.
